Pole Barn Demolition in Bergen County, NJ

Pole barn demolition services involve safely dismantling and removing existing pole barns or similar structures from residential properties. This service is often requested when homeowners want to clear space for new construction, repurpose land, or eliminate outdated or damaged buildings. Projects can range from partial dismantling of sections to complete removal of entire pole barn structures, including foundation removal and debris cleanup. Property owners should consider factors such as the size and condition of the structure, access to the site, and any local regulations or permits required before requesting demolition services.

Before requesting pole barn demolition, property owners typically want to understand the scope of work involved, including what parts of the structure will be removed and how debris will be handled. It’s also helpful to know if any permits are necessary and whether utilities need to be disconnected beforehand. Clear communication about the structure’s materials and location can assist in planning a safe and efficient demolition process. This service ensures that the site is properly cleared, making way for future projects or land use changes.

Pole Barn Demolition Questions

What is pole barn demolition? It involves safely tearing down and removing existing pole barns from a property to make way for new projects or clear space.

What types of pole barns can be demolished? Various structures, including wooden, metal, or combination pole barns, can be taken down depending on construction.

Is demolition suitable for old or damaged pole barns? Yes, demolition is often chosen for structures that are unsafe, outdated, or beyond repair.

What should property owners consider before demolition? It's important to evaluate site access, debris removal options, and any necessary permits for the project.
